London, White and Cochrane, 1811, First edition. . contemporary full leather, rebacked with matching spine with gilt rules, gilt title lettering on spine leather spine label, marbled edges, small scratch mark on cover, interior is clean and fine in sound and tight vg binding. . 8vo [22 x 14 cm]; 2 volumes bound in one, xvi, 366; 306 [ii, ads] pp, illustrations are woodcuts by Richard T. Austin, index, errata at end of volume II. . Cox i, 188: "An important and interesting work on Lapland and parts of Norway and Sweden. This famous botanist was himself the instigator of a large number of scientific voyages." Catalogue of the Works of Linnaeus in British Museum (1933) #188. Soulsby 192. Hulth 160. Junk p. 59: 'wichtung und selten'. Sansbergs Bokhandel, catalogue 12, p. 117: "Linnaeus started his work of investigation during his early manhood with his journeys to the Swedish provinces, where he noted the natural resources of the country-side. In the summer of 1741 he visited Oland and Gotland, in 1746 Vastergotland and Bohuslan and Skane in 1749. His accounts of these trips are his most often read works. They are of great topographical interest and abound in his observations of nature, animal and plant life as well as in ethnographical and economical matters. His geological remarks are of particular interest. The style is Linnaeus's usual: short, direct and to the point, often shot through with humour and touched with a lyrical love for nature." Smith bought Linnaeus's manuscripts and brought them back to England. The first Swedish edition was not until 1888. A picture of this book is available on request by email.
